I have a Mac computer: operating system OSX10.3.9 (emac G4.1.1)

I just purchased a new 3G iPod Nano and tried to download my songs onto it, this would not work and I was told I needed an operating system OSX10.4.9 or newer.

Is there a solution to this or do I need a new computer?

Thanks for any help.

Yeah, I dont think it'd work. You need at least a certain version of iTunes to sync the iPod with, otherwise that model won't be recognised, but 10.3, as you've stated, isn't supported by the new versions of iTunes and, as a result, you can't use your iPod with it. You'll have to get access to a computer with OS X 10.4 or 10.5, or Windows XP SP2 or later.

Also you'll want to make sure your Mac has USB-2 ports. Not 100% certain but I don't think iTunes will sync an iPod using USB-1.1. I've got an iMac G3 that won't sync and also an old PowerMac (QS) that will sync just fine now that I added aftermarket USB-2 ports.

Note however that if you were able to locate an older iPod (perhaps a FireWire iPod 2nd/3rd Generation) it would probably sync just fine on any Mac of its same vintage. :apple:
